Now onto the food!

Lesley and I split the Frito Misto – crispy cauliflower, sweet chili sauce, sesame seeds. Everyone raves about this as being the best dish in the restaurant!

V0011163

Needless to say, it was amazing. Picture sweet and sour chicken balls, but made with cauliflower pieces!!! So cool.

Compliments of the chef- some corn pesto ‘bread’ It was quite tasty!

V0011166

For the main course I got the Bangkok Raw – bok choy & Napa cabbage, cucumbers, peppers, carrots, broccoli, cilantro, basil, mint, garlic-ginger sauce

V0011170

I knew that I wanted to eat something very healthy for my dinner, given our wild night last night. ;) I had it with a slice of Eric’s pizza as well as the mushroom pizza given to me by Kelly and Stacey.

V0011173

YUM!

Fun fact- Pamela Anderson loves this restaurant and frequently visits.
